Valley Stream sits in a commuter-heavy corridor, and motorcycle crashes here often involve fast-moving traffic patterns—merging, left turns, and sudden stops near busy roadways. When insurers evaluate a claim, they look closely at:
- What traffic behavior caused the crash (yielding, lane changes, turning decisions)
- Whether evidence supports your version of events (photos, witnesses, dash/traffic camera availability)
- How quickly and consistently you got treatment after the incident
AI tools can’t confirm those facts. They can only model outcomes based on assumptions you enter. That’s why two people can both “get a number” and still end up with very different settlement results.
